ONE WORKSTATION CANNOT CONNECT TO STAFF MODULE ------------------------------------------------- B1. Check to see if the problem module works on any other computer at your site. If the software works on one or more other computers... B2. Exit the module on the problem computer and restart the module. Perform some action requiring server response. If the module still does not function... B3. Check to see that the server IP address and ports in the 'voyager.ini' file are correct. Restart the module. If the module still does not function... B4. Shutdown Windows and restart your computer. If this does not solve the problem, call your local technical support office. C. CANNOT LOG INTO CATALOGING MODULE ------------------------------------ If you are connected to the Cataloging module and are disconnected, and you try to reconnect, you may not get the login screen, just an error that says something like "Cataloging not found in voyager.ini file." Reopening the module or rebooting the computer may not solve the problem if the server thinks the computer is still connected and is locking the connection to the computer's IP address. The connection should eventually time out, but you can try the following procedure. C1. Close Voyager Cataloging module. C2. Edit the 'voyager.ini' file in the Voyager directory on your hard drive using a text editor (Windows Notepad). C3. Go to the [Cataloging] stanza. If the port says 7010, change to 8010, or if 8010, change to 7010. Save changes to file. C4. Open up the Cataloging module and log on, then exit the module normally. C5. Open the 'voyager.ini' file again and edit the Cataloging port back to it's original number; then save file. C6. Open the Cataloging module to see if you can log in. Include your name, telephone number and library. Tell Systems the results of the above steps. F. ONE WORKSTATION CANNOT CONNECT TO WEBVOYAGE ---------------------------------------------- F1. Check to see if WebVoyage works on any other computer at your site. If WebVoyage works on one or more other computers... F2. Make sure you are using the correct URL for WebVoyage. If WebVoyage still does not function... F3. Restart the browser. If WebVoyage still does not function... F4. Shutdown Windows and restart your computer. If Webvoyage still does not function... F5. Check to see that the browser and any security software are set up as usual, i.e. that they have not been altered inappropriately. If the problem continues, contact your local computer support staff.
